• We consider the unit commitment constraint screening problem under forecasting uncertainty, which holds great potential for accelerating UC solution and providing reliable decisions. • This work takes an early step in extending the classic deterministic screening framework to accommodate uncertainty-aware UC models. Both principled modeling and solving techniques are proposed for constraint screening under uncertainties. • This work improves the screening efficiency by developing novel affine policies to replace the screening model and proposing a multi-area screening approach for large-scale systems.
